MCNV2 Toolbox ============= Welcome to the MCNV2 documentation. MCNV2 is a technology-agnostic toolbox for CNV quality assessment using Mendelian Precision in parent–offspring trios. .. note:: This documentation covers both the interactive **Shiny application** and the **command-line interface (CLI)** for batch processing. Getting Started --------------- .. grid:: 2 .. grid-item-card:: Installation :link: getting-started/installation :link-type: doc Install MCNV2 (R + Python) and validate your environment. .. grid-item-card:: Quickstart :link: getting-started/quickstart :link-type: doc Run your first Mendelian Precision analysis in minutes. Tutorials --------- .. grid:: 2 .. grid-item-card:: Shiny Tutorial :link: tutorials/shiny_tutorial :link-type: doc Interactive exploration: filters, plots, exports. .. grid-item-card:: CLI Tutorial :link: tutorials/cli_tutorial :link-type: doc Batch runs, reproducible pipelines, and wrappers. Core Concepts ------------- - :doc:`user-guide/mendelian_precision` — Understand the MP metric - :doc:`user-guide/inheritance` — Inheritance status calculation - :doc:`user-guide/filtering` — Quality filters and their impact .. toctree:: :maxdepth: 1 :caption: Getting Started :hidden: getting-started/index .. toctree:: :maxdepth: 2 :caption: User Guide :hidden: user-guide/index .. toctree:: :maxdepth: 1 :caption: Tutorials :hidden: tutorials/index .. toctree:: :maxdepth: 1 :caption: Reference :hidden: reference/index .. toctree:: :maxdepth: 1 :caption: About :hidden: about/index Indices and tables ================== * :ref:`genindex` * :ref:`search`